Living pebble thrives when propagated through the precise method of sowing. Gardeners should focus on using fresh seeds for optimal germination, ensuring that they are sowed in well-draining soil mixes specific to succulents, which typically include components like perlite or sand to enhance aeration and drainage. The delicate nature of the seeds calls for a gentle approach—lightly cover them with a thin layer of soil or sand, and maintain minimal yet consistent moisture without causing waterlogging, which can be detrimental. Successfully growing living pebble from seed requires patience but rewards with thriving, visually appealing specimens.
